In recent years, China has been at the forefront of the global data analytics and statistics landscape. The country's rapid digitalization and technological advancements have fueled a surge in the generation and processing of vast amounts of data. As businesses, government agencies, and research institutions harness the power of data analytics, a myriad of perspectives and controversies have emerged, shaping the evolving data landscape in China. Perspectives: 1. Technological Advancements: China's emphasis on innovation and technology has propelled the country to become a global leader in data analytics. The development of cutting-edge technologies such as artificial intelligence, machine learning, and big data analytics has enabled organizations to extract valuable insights from data, driving business growth and innovation. 2. Economic Growth: The integration of data analytics into various sectors of the Chinese economy has contributed to sustainable growth and development. By leveraging data-driven strategies, businesses can enhance operational efficiency, optimize marketing campaigns, and improve customer experiences, ultimately boosting economic performance. 3. Strategic Planning: Data analytics plays a crucial role in informing decision-making processes across different sectors in China. By analyzing market trends, consumer behaviors, and social dynamics, organizations can make informed strategic decisions that align with their objectives and drive sustainable growth. Controversies: 1. Data Privacy Concerns: The extensive collection and utilization of personal data in China have raised concerns about data privacy and security. Instances of data breaches, unauthorized data sharing, and surveillance activities have fueled public debates on the ethical implications of data analytics practices. 2. Regulatory Challenges: China's regulatory framework for data analytics and statistics is still evolving, resulting in regulatory uncertainties and compliance challenges for organizations operating in the data space. Striking a balance between promoting innovation and protecting data privacy remains a key challenge for policymakers and industry stakeholders. 3. Ethical Dilemmas: The use of data analytics for purposes such as surveillance, social credit scoring, and personalized targeting has sparked ethical dilemmas surrounding individual rights, transparency, and accountability. The ethical implications of data analytics practices have prompted calls for greater oversight and ethical standards in the industry. In conclusion, the perspectives and controversies surrounding statistics and data analytics in China reflect the complex interplay between technological advancements, economic growth, regulatory challenges, and ethical considerations. As China continues to harness the power of data analytics for innovation and development, it is essential for stakeholders to address the emerging issues, foster transparency, and uphold ethical standards to ensure the responsible and sustainable use of data in the country's evolving digital landscape.
